NSP (Nintendo Submission Package) files are a type of file format used by Nintendo for distributing and installing games and other content on the Nintendo Switch console. These files contain the game's data, including its code, assets, and metadata. NSP files are typically used for digital distribution through the Nintendo eShop, but they can also be used for installing homebrew or demo versions of games.
